Finns Love Lumia! 1 million Nokia Lumia in Finland, population 5 million Finns!

Finns Love Lumia! 1 million Nokia Lumia in Finland, population 5 million Finns!

| March 1, 2014 | 27 Replies

Considering that there are only 5 million Finnish people in the whole of Finland, it’s quite remarkable to consider that there are now 1 million Nokia Lumia handsets in the country. Whatsapp background and privacy control features:

Whatsapp background and privacy control features:

| February 28, 2014 | 3 Replies

A private beta of Whatsapp recently got an update and brings with it some neat features. This includes some custom backgrounds for your messages and also some privacy controls, detailing who can see when you were last online, your profile photo and status.
